13 multiple choice 5 points when representatives of both union and management meet to discuss goals, offer solutions and compromises, and work toward a contract settlement, the two sides are engaging in which of the following? mediation arbitration lockouts collective bargaining
Answer
Brief Explanations:
Mediation involves a neutral third - party helping to resolve disputes. Arbitration is when a third - party makes a binding decision. Lockouts are employer - imposed work stoppages. Collective bargaining is when union and management representatives directly discuss goals, offer solutions and compromises to reach a contract settlement.
Answer:
D. Collective bargaining
